gmail = spam generator / privacy breach.

From Google's privacy statement:

If you click on an ad, Google will send a referring URL to the advertiser's site identifying that you are visiting from Gmail. Google does not send personally identifying information to advertisers with the referring URL. Once you are on the advertiser's site, however, the advertiser may collect personal information about you. Google does not control or take responsibility for the privacy policies of other sites.

While unencryted email is not secure, other services do not actively scan email and develop profiles on you.
